Find Your Private Local Tour Guide in Istanbul, Turkey - Türkiye
Languages Arabic, Cantonese, English, French, German, Indonesian, Italian, Japanese, ...
2147451
Languages Arabic, Dutch, English, French, Portuguese, Russian, Spanish
98565
Languages Bulgarian, Dutch, English, French, German, Greek (modern), Italian, Japanese, ...
2620













